Surveillance Data Disputes The Staff persists in the argument that sister plant surveillance data, viz., scientific evidence of embrittlement from completely different types of nuclear reactors, can be compared, apples-to-apples, with destructive testing data gleaned from metal coupons retrieved from the Palisades RPV. The Staff urges that the § 50.61a(10) definition of surveillance data includes other plants information within its sweep, and that every reference to surveillance data automatically means not just Palisades, but other plants.3 Only through such a misleading insistence can the Staff proclaim (Staff Answer pp. 21-22) that If these [§ 50.61a(f)(6)] criteria are met, the rule requires the applicant to use the surveillance data to verify that its predicted reference temperatures are appropriate.

But no matter how obfuscatory its arguments, the Staff cannot get around the fact that 10 C.F.R. § 50.61a(f)(6)(i) requires that (A) The surveillance material must be a heat-specific match for one or more of the materials for which RTMAX-X is being calculated. Gundersen has attested to the lack of proof that the metals from the various RPVs match.

The Staff manipulates engineer Gundersens testimony by selectively citing (Staff Answer p. 21) his observation that an exhaustive review of NRC regulations has not unveiled any regulations that allow for such comparisons, and no record of scientific validation of such 3

Staff Answer p. 21: Thus, whenever the term surveillance data is used in § 50.61a, it includes surveillance data from other plants.

methodology. The Staff then terms this an inappropriate challenge to NRC regulations and, adding injury to that insult, accuses Gundersen and Petitioners (Staff Answer p. 22) of saying that Entergy should not be allowed to analyze sister-plant data at all.

But the Staff omits to respond - deliberately, one must conclude - to Gundersens further opinion, cited at Petitioners Amended Petition p. 15, where in a section entitled The Comparable Plants Are Not Apples-to-Apples Comparisons, Gundersen offers these conclusions:

These plants, which he says thus far have not exhibited significant signs of reactor metal embrittlement, are poor comparables because

. . . the dramatically different nuclear core design and operational power characteristics make an accurate comparison impossible. The difference between the Westinghouse nuclear cores and the Combustion Engineering nuclear core impacts the neutron flux on each reactor vessel, thus making an accurate comparison of neutron bombardment and embrittlement impossible.

Id. at p. 10, ¶ 27.

It is thus misrepresentative for the Staff to maintain that Gundersen did not critique the surveillance samples from other plants according to § 50.61a(f)(6) criteria.

Even if the ASLB were to conclude that Arnold Gundersen was incorrect in asserting that no rule governs the comparison of Palisades embrittlement data with that from other nuclear reactors, a contention about a matter not covered by a specific rule need only allege that the matter poses a significant safety problem. That is sufficient to raise an issue under the general requirement for operating licenses, 10 C.F.R. § 50.57(a)(3), for a finding of reasonable assurance of operation without endangering the health and safety of the public. Duke Power Co. (Catawba Nuclear Station, Units 1 & 2), LBP-82-116, 16 NRC 1937, 1946 (1982).

Related to this dispute, the Staff points out (Staff Answer p. 19 fn. 80) that Arnold Gundersen incorrectly attributed to the ACRS these statements - the use of all possible physical samples is important to an accurate outcome . . . the vehicle for doing that is doing a statistical comparison of a particular reactors plant specific surveillance data with the general trends.

Petitioners acknowledge that they mistakenly believed these were statements made by a member of the Advisory Committee on Reactor Safeguards, and they admit their error. The speaker is the principal NRC staff expert on embrittlement, Mark Kirk of the NRC Office of Regulatory Research and longtime point person on this issue. Kirk is the primary author of § 50.61a, so coming from him, the acknowledgment that the use of all possible physical samples is important to an accurate outcome bolsters Petitioners case even more than if it were a statement by an ACRS member being briefed by an NRC staff expert.

Staff Pretensions At Expertise After dispensing with the Staffs disingenuous contention that every expert conclusion proffered by Petitioners is an impermissible challenge to NRC regulations, an underlying weakness to the agencys arguments is exposed: the NRC Staff has not met Petitioners experts conclusions with its own expert evidence. Presumably, qualified NRC engineers are vetting Entergys License Amendment Request, but theyre nowhere in sight in the Staffs Answer.

Instead, the Staffs tactic is to float unsupported conclusions, faux expert representations, tendered via lawyers.

For example, the Staff criticizes Arnold Gundersens testimony on the subject of error band overlap at its Answer, p. 25 in this way:

The Petitioners assert that it is difficult to compare the data from Palisades with data from four other plants, because of the need to assure that the 20% error band[s]

overlap. According to the Petitioners, To compare this different data without assurance that the 1ó variance [sic] from each plant overlaps the other plants lacks scientific validity. In addition, in discussing the differences in flux and fluence from cycle-to-cycle at Palisades, the Petitioners argue that it is mathematically implausible that the needed deviation was obtained. The Petitioners therefore argue that additional testing and analysis is needed to support relicensure.

But in fact, Gundersen stated a scientific criticism with regulatory-violation overtones, i.e., that there is a need for consistency in comparing the 20% error band among the sister plants and that under 10 C.F.R. §50.61a, Entergy has not made that showing. By its very construction, Gundersens opinion is predicated on adequate facts taken from the License Amendment Request (LAR):

While [a] 1ó analysis appears to be binding within the Palisades data, . . . the NRC lowers the bar when comparing data from similar sister plants that are included in Entergys analysis of the Palisades reactor vessel without requiring the same 1ó variance with Palisades. Id. at p. 12, ¶ 32. Gundersen adds: There can be no assurance that the 20% error band at Palisades encompasses the 20% error band at the Robinson or Indian Point plants. To compare this different data without assurance that the 1ó variance from each plant overlaps the other plants lacks scientific validity. Id. at p. 12, ¶ 33.

Amended Petition p. 18.

In support of the continuity and consistency of Petitioners contention, their expert Gundersen found that there is extraordinary variability between the neutron flux across the nuclear core in this Combustion Engineering reactor because of a flux variation of as much as 300% between the 45-degree segment and the 75-degree segment, calling it mathematically implausible that a 20% deviation is possible when the neutron flux itself varies by 300%. Id. at

p. 12, ¶ 34. Gundersens final opinion on this point is:

The Westinghouse Analysis delineates that a 20% variation is mandatory, yet the effective fluence variability can be as high as 300%, therefore, the analytical data does not support relicensure without destructive testing and complete embrittlement analysis of additional capsule samples.

Gundersen Report at p. 16, ¶ 39.

The Lack Of Thermal Shield Is Relevant Evidence Petitioners have the same response concerning the Staffs bickering that mentioning the lack of a thermal shield is not relevant to whether superficial paperwork requirements have been met concerning 10 C.F.R. § 50.61a. Petitioners are urging none of what the Staff alleges - that is, Petitioners are not trying to predicate a contention on what Palisades prior owner should have done. The lack of a thermal shield emphasizes the unfettered neutron fluence to which the RPV has been continuously exposed for over 43 years. It tends to prove that a science-based regulatory determination of Palisades embrittlement may be preferable to the use of probabilistic risk assessment in the circumstances of this reactor.

G. Prior License Amendments Enabling More Embrittlement Are Relevant Evidence For the Staff to seriously posit that the multiple past increases of the trigger temperature (the Staffs term) are not admissible evidence is laughable. Their objection pertains to the forthcoming adjudication of this matter which should be held. It is incumbent upon an expert to disclose the bases for his/her opinion. Quite rationally, Arnold Gundersens analysis was that the date at which the trigger temperature was exceeded kept getting longer. The rollbacks were of the date and also the temperature. The pattern of those rollbacks is of importance to scrutinizing and understanding the pending § 50.61a application. Too, a 230 degrees F. increase in the trigger temperature over 43+ years is relevant information. The regulation - 10 C.F.R. § 50.61a(d)(1) -

makes it relevant:

Whenever there is a significant change in projected values of RTMAX-X, so that the previous value, the current value, or both values, exceed the screening criteria before the expiration of the plant operating license; or upon the licensees request for a change in the expiration date for operation of the facility; a re-assessment of RTMAX-X values documented consistent with the requirements of paragraph (c)(1) and (c)(3) of this section must be submitted in the form of a license amendment for review and approval by the Director. (Emphasis added).

III. Responses To Entergys Answer A. Standing Entergy hints that there is no meaningful relief that would follow a decision adverse to its interests on the License Amendment Request. Entergy Answer at p. 14/37 of .pdf. Given the stage of Palisades operating life and the severe, undeniable embrittlement of the reactor pressure vessel, it is possible that the ASLB could overturn or deny recourse to Entergy under 10 C.F.R. § 50.61a, which would force a decision on the utility to undertake the annealing of the RPV, or perhaps, if the economics of that remedy were prohibitive, for the reactor to be permanently shutdown, and decommissioned. If the former relief were ordered or followed from a denial of § 50.61a amendment, Petitioners would benefit from safety enhancements to Palisades operations.

If the latter relief occurred, they would benefit even more since the risks from decommissioning would principally attend management of spent fuel at the reactor site as well as the cleanup of radioactive contamination.

Entergy urges that the Petitioners are not entitled to rely on the proximity presumption to establish standing. Even if the ASLB were to accept the proposition that a through-wall crack or shattering of the Palisades RPV cannot conceivably form the heart of a dangerous nuclear reactor accident, residence or activities within 10 miles of a facility (and in one case 17 miles from a facility) have been found sufficient to establish standing in a case involving the proposed expansion in capacity of a spent fuel pool. See Vermont Yankee Nuclear Power Corp. (Vermont Yankee Nuclear Power Station), LBP-87-7, 25 NRC 116, 118 (1987); see also Florida Power &

Light Co. (St. Lucie Nuclear Power Plant, Unit 1), LBP-88-10A, 27 NRC 452-454-55 (1988),

affd, ALAB-893, 27 NRC 627 (1988); Carolina Power & Light Co. (Shearon Harris Nuclear Power Plant), LBP-99-25, 50 NRC 25, 29-31 (1999); Northeast Nuclear Energy Co. (Millstone Nuclear Power Station, Unit 3), LBP-00-2, 51 NRC 25 (2000). Maynard Kaufman, one of the individuals who has provided a declaration and is represented by Michigan Safe Energy Future-Shoreline Chapter, lives within 10 miles of Palisades. Bette Pierman, represented by Beyond Nuclear, lives within 15 miles. Gail Snyder, represented by Nuclear Energy Information Service, camps and picnics on property she owns about 15 miles from Palisades. At least these three intervening organizations thus overcome a reduced radius (Alice Hirt, represented by Dont Waste Michigan, lives 35 miles from the reactor). In a proceeding reviewing an extended power uprate application, an organization had representational standing where its representative members each lived within 15 miles of the plant. Entergy Nuclear Vermont Yankee, L.L.C. and Entergy Nuclear Operations, Inc. (Vermont Yankee Nuclear Power Station), LBP-04-28, 60 NRC 548, 553-54 (2004).

Moreover, residence within 30-40 miles of a reactor site has been held to be sufficient to show the requisite interest in raising safety questions. Virginia Electric & Power Co. (North Anna Power Station, Units 1 & 2), ALAB-146, 6 AEC 631, 633-634 (1973); Louisiana Power &

Light Co. (Waterford Steam Electric Station, Unit 3), ALAB-125, 6 AEC 371, 372 n.6 (1973);

Northern States Power Co. (Prairie Island Nuclear Generating Plant, Units 1 & 2), ALAB-107, 6 AEC 188, 190, 193, reconsid. den., ALAB-110, 6 AEC 247, affd, CLI-73-12, 6 AEC 241 (1973); Florida Power and Light Co. (St. Lucie Nuclear Power Plant, Unit 1), LBP-88-10A, 27 NRC 452, 454-55 (1988), affd on other grounds, ALAB-893, 27 NRC 627 (1988).

Turning to Entergys other standing objections, the utility suggests (Entergy Answer p.

13/37) that Petitioners are making a general objection to the plants operations. That is incorrect.

The contention raised by Petitioners is quite particular, in that it is an objection to any further weakening of pressurized thermal shock (PTS) safety standards. The chain of causation which Entergy maintains has not been made is that if there were a PTS event, it could cause RPV failure and core meltdown, accompanied by containment failure, followed by catastrophic radioactivity release. Safety concerns which carry the potential for offsite consequences enable standing.

Cleveland Elec. Illuminating Co. (Perry Nuclear Power Plant, Unit 1), CLI-93-21, 38 NRC 87, 95-96 (1993). In ruling on claims of proximity standing, the Commission determines the radius beyond which it believes there is no longer an obvious potential for offsite consequences by taking into account the nature of the proposed action and the significance of the radioactive source. Entergy Nuclear Operations and Entergy Nuclear Palisades, LLC (Palisades Nuclear Plant), CLI-08-19, 68 NRC 251, 254 (2008).

Petitioners submit here that a pressurized thermal shock-caused failure of a reactor pressure vessel raises an obvious potential for offsite consequences. Even in license amendment cases involving allegations of management's lack of the required character and competence, there is deemed to be an obvious potential for offsite cónsequences, so standing is analogous to that in an operating license case. Florida Power and Light Co. (St. Lucie Nuclear Power Plant, Units 1 and 2), CLI-89-21, 30 NRC 325 (1989).

The NRC Staffs Unannounced Succor For Embrittled Nuclear Power Plant Owners When Compliance Even With § 50.61a Is A Bridge Too Far In the end, for extremely-embrittled RPVs, 10 C.F.R. § 50.61a contains an obscure, little-noticed bypass provision whereby the NRC Director of NRR may allow selected embrittled reactors to operate beyond the PTS screening criteria. At the 619th Meeting of the Advisory Committee on Reactor Safeguards, Mark Kirk of the Office of Nuclear Regulatory Research and the principal author of 10 C.F.R. § 50.61a, presented a slide show, Technical Brief on Regulatory Guidance on the Alternative PTS Rule (10 C.F.R. § 50.61a). Official Transcript of Proceedings, ADAMS No. ML14321A542, commencing at p. 202/268 of .pdf. The slide at p.

242 of the transcript contains the following information:

Use of 10 CFR 50.61a PTS screening criteria requires submittal for review and approval by Director, NRR.

For plants that do not satisfy PTS Screening Criteria, plant-specific PTS assessment is required.

Must be submitted for review and approval by Director, NRR.

Guidance is not provided for this case Subsequent requirements (i.e., after submittal) are defined in paragraph (d) of 10 CFR 50.61a. (Emphasis supplied).
